阿里云國際站充值:ASPNET筆記之ListView與DropDownList的使用
在現(xiàn)代的Web開發(fā)中,用戶界面(UI)的設(shè)計和交互體驗(yàn)尤為重要。在使用ASP.NET進(jìn)行開發(fā)時,ListView和DropDownList是兩個非常常見的控件,它們可以有效地幫助開發(fā)人員展示和選擇數(shù)據(jù)。在這篇文章中,我們將結(jié)合阿里云國際站充值系統(tǒng)的案例,探討如何使用ASP.NET中的ListView與DropDownList控件,同時還會介紹阿里云提供的強(qiáng)大優(yōu)勢,幫助開發(fā)人員更好地搭建高效且穩(wěn)定的Web應(yīng)用。
什么是ListView與DropDownList控件
在ASP.NET中,ListView和DropDownList是常用的控件,用于展示和處理數(shù)據(jù)。ListView控件通常用于顯示具有多個字段的數(shù)據(jù)列表,并允許開發(fā)者自定義顯示的方式;而DropDownList控件則用于展示一組選項,并允許用戶從中選擇一個選項。兩者的靈活性和擴(kuò)展性使它們在開發(fā)中有著廣泛的應(yīng)用。
ListView控件的使用
ListView控件是一個高度可定制的數(shù)據(jù)展示控件,它能夠以不同的格式(如表格、列表、網(wǎng)格等)來展示數(shù)據(jù)。開發(fā)人員可以通過綁定數(shù)據(jù)源(如數(shù)據(jù)庫、XML文件等)來填充ListView,并通過模板進(jìn)行定制顯示。
在阿里云國際站的充值系統(tǒng)中,ListView控件能夠用于展示用戶的充值記錄。例如,可以展示用戶的充值金額、充值時間、支付方式等信息。通過ListView的強(qiáng)大功能,開發(fā)人員可以方便地為用戶提供一目了然的充值歷史記錄。
ListView的常見用法
在實(shí)際開發(fā)中,ListView控件的使用非常簡單。首先需要設(shè)置數(shù)據(jù)源(例如:SQL查詢、Web服務(wù)等),然后使用模板來定制數(shù)據(jù)顯示方式。下面是一個基本的示例代碼:
<%# Eval("RechargeAmount") %>
<%# Eval("RechargeDate") %>
<%# Eval("PaymentMethod") %>
在這個例子中,ListView控件從一個數(shù)據(jù)源(例如SQL數(shù)據(jù)庫)中獲取充值記錄,并通過
DropDownList控件的使用
DropDownList控件是ASP.NET中用于提供下拉選擇框的控件。它常用于提供固定選項供用戶選擇,如支付方式、貨幣類型等。在阿里云國際站的充值系統(tǒng)中,DropDownList控件通常用于選擇充值的金額或支付方式等。
與ListView控件的靈活性相比,DropDownList更側(cè)重于交互性和選項的展示。通過DropDownList控件,開發(fā)人員可以快速創(chuàng)建一個直觀的選擇框,幫助用戶進(jìn)行快速選擇。
DropDownList的常見用法
使用DropDownList控件時,開發(fā)人員需要提前配置數(shù)據(jù)源,或者手動添加列表項。下面是一個簡單的DropDownList使用示例:
在這個示例中,DropDownList控件被用來展示三種支付方式,用戶可以根據(jù)自己的需求選擇一種支付方式進(jìn)行充值。

結(jié)合阿里云優(yōu)勢:提升性能與穩(wěn)定性
在Web開發(fā)中,尤其是在進(jìn)行在線支付和充值等業(yè)務(wù)時,性能和穩(wěn)定性是至關(guān)重要的。阿里云憑借其領(lǐng)先的云計算技術(shù)和全球化的數(shù)據(jù)中心,能夠?yàn)殚_發(fā)者提供強(qiáng)大而穩(wěn)定的云服務(wù),確保Web應(yīng)用的流暢運(yùn)行。
阿里云國際站通過云服務(wù)器、數(shù)據(jù)庫、CDN、負(fù)載均衡等一系列解決方案,為開發(fā)者提供高可用、高性能的支持。通過利用阿里云的資源,開發(fā)者不僅可以獲得更好的數(shù)據(jù)存儲和處理能力,還可以確保Web應(yīng)用在全球范圍內(nèi)的訪問速度和穩(wěn)定性。
阿里云的高可用性
阿里云擁有多個數(shù)據(jù)中心和CDN節(jié)點(diǎn),能夠?qū)崿F(xiàn)數(shù)據(jù)的冗余備份和全球加速。對于需要高可用性的Web應(yīng)用,阿里云提供的多區(qū)域部署和負(fù)載均衡服務(wù)是非常理想的選擇。例如,在處理大規(guī)模充值請求時,阿里云的負(fù)載均衡技術(shù)能夠有效地分配流量,避免服務(wù)器超載,從而確保用戶能夠快速完成支付。
阿里云的安全性
阿里云還提供多層次的安全防護(hù)措施,包括DDoS攻擊防護(hù)、Web應(yīng)用防火墻(WAF)、數(shù)據(jù)加密等服務(wù)。這些安全措施能夠有效地保護(hù)Web應(yīng)用免受攻擊,確保用戶的充值過程安全、可靠。
如何利用阿里云提升ASP.NET開發(fā)效率
對于ASP.NET開發(fā)者來說,使用阿里云的云服務(wù)器和云數(shù)據(jù)庫服務(wù)可以大大提升開發(fā)效率和維護(hù)便利性。例如,阿里云的RDS(關(guān)系型數(shù)據(jù)庫服務(wù))可以無縫連接ASP.NET應(yīng)用,提供高效的數(shù)據(jù)處理能力。同時,阿里云的OSS(對象存儲服務(wù))還可以為開發(fā)者提供簡便的文件存儲解決方案。
此外,阿里云提供的開發(fā)者工具和SDK也使得與云服務(wù)的集成變得更加簡單。例如,阿里云的OSS SDK可以直接與ASP.NET應(yīng)用集成,幫助開發(fā)者快速實(shí)現(xiàn)文件上傳、下載等操作。
總結(jié)
通過結(jié)合阿里云的強(qiáng)大云計算平臺,ASP.NET開發(fā)者能夠構(gòu)建高效、穩(wěn)定和安全的Web應(yīng)用。在開發(fā)過程中,ListView與DropDownList控件是非常重要的UI元素,它們能夠幫助開發(fā)者提供直觀、易用的交互界面。在阿里云的技術(shù)支持下,開發(fā)者不僅能夠提高開發(fā)效率,還能保證應(yīng)用的性能和安全性。通過阿里云的云服務(wù),開發(fā)者可以專注于應(yīng)用本身,而無需過多擔(dān)心基礎(chǔ)設(shè)施的維護(hù)問題。
